Jade Cargill supposedly had to turn down a major presentation-related pitch during her AEW run due to Liv Morgan. The revelation was recently shared by the newly-crowned WWE champion's former manager, Mark Sterling. "The Storm" was in action last weekend at Saturday Night's Main Event, where she defeated Tiffany Stratton to become the new WWE Women's Champion. The victory earned Jade her very first singles title in the sports entertainment juggernaut. While Cargill's run in the Triple H-led promotion has been arguably quite successful so far, the Florida-native did enjoy a similarly dominant run in AEW, where she began her professional wrestling journey back in 2021. Jade's former All Elite Wrestling manager, "Smart" Mark Sterling, recently appeared at a virtual signing for K & S WrestleFest, during which he revealed that the ex-TBS Champion had once intended to sport Catwoman-inspired ring-gear for an AEW pay-per-view. However, she eventually had to dismiss the idea after Liv Morgan appeared in a suit based on the same character in WWE. Morgan had donned a Catwoman outfit at WrestleMania 38 in April, 2022. It is likely, therefore, that Jade may have planned to wear hers for Double or Nothing in May. “I was not aware I was gonna do this, but I knew that I was managing Jade (Cargill) later… So Jade was gonna wear a Catwoman gear on pay-per-view. So I bought this Riddler-inspired suit… And she was gonna be Catwoman and then, like the week before, I think Liv Morgan came out in a Catwoman gear. She didn’t wanna do it anymore.” [H/T - Fightful]Morgan and Cargill have worked with and even wrestled each other since the latter made her in-ring debut for WWE last year.
